danmaku icon

The Greatest American Hero S01E07 - My Heroes Have Always Been Cowboys

6 ViewsFeb 20, 2025

The Greatest American Hero S01E07 - My Heroes Have Always Been Cowboys
warn iconRepost is prohibited without the creator's permission.
creator avatar

Recommended for You

  • All
  • Anime